FAM T1 - Households by composition
Household type Number of households Household population
2012 % 2017 % 2023 % 2012 2017 2023
Altogether 80 619 100,0 81 691 100,0 85 004 100,0 196 345 193 734 193 714
One-person households (male and female) 23 319 28,9 25 513 31,2 29 508 34,7 23 319 25 513 29 508
 Single Male 8 440 10,5 9 817 12,0 11 759 13,8 8 440 9 817 11 759
 Single Female 14 878 18,5 15 696 19,2 17 749 20,9 14 878 15 696 17 749
Other households without families 1 832 2,3 1 260 1,5 1 049 1,2 4 731 3 101 2 352
Family households : 55 468 68,8 54 919 67,2 54 447 64,1 168 296 165 120 161 855
 Couple without children 21 724 26,9 21 287 26,1 20 906 24,6 44 718 43 627 42 676
 Couple with children 25 154 31,2 24 460 29,9 23 031 27,1 99 905 96 775 90 884
 Single parent 8 591 10,7 9 172 11,2 10 510 12,4 23 673 24 718 28 294
  • Sources : Insee, RP2012, RP2017 and RP2023,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2026.

FAM G1 - Growth estimates of households’ size since 1968
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2007 2012 2017 2023
Average number of occupants per main residence 3,41 3,22 2,99 2,86 2,69 2,50 2,43 2,37 2,28
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for the over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ope
  • in the geography in force on 01/01/2026.
  • Sources :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ts RP2012 to RP2023 main holdings

FAM T3 - Families composition
Type of family 2012 % 2017 % 2023 %
Altogether 55 896 100,0 55 374 100,0 54 843 100,0
Couple with children 25 174 45,0 24 518 44,3 23 073 42,1
Single parent 8 910 15,9 9 443 17,1 10 772 19,6
 Male single parent 1 312 2,3 1 369 2,5 1 817 3,3
 Female single parent 7 598 13,6 8 074 14,6 8 954 16,3
Couple without children 21 812 39,0 21 413 38,7 20 999 38,3
  • Sources : Insee, RP2012, RP2017 and RP2023,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2026.
